Trans-Tasman bubble: Insurance won't cover border closures

From Morning Report, 8:24 am on 23 March 2021

Travel insurers are warning those eyeing up a trans-Tasman bubble to get cover early and to read the fine print of their policies carefully.

Companies will not provide cover for anyone affected by government-imposed actions including border closures and lockdowns.

It comes as the Government prepares to announce on 6 April when the eagerly awaited trans-Tasman travel bubble will open.

Insurance Council chief executive Tim Grafton spoke to Susie Ferguson.
